pop/off/art is one of the leading contemporary art galleries in Russia. The gallery represents not only Russian artists (including those who live abroad) but also a number of international artists with a focus on post-soviet space authors of Eastern and Central Europe. The gallery is included in top-5 Russian galleries (according to Forbes magazine) and in top-500 world galleries (Blouin Artinfo).
pop/off/art gallery was founded in 2004 in Moscow by the art critic Sergey Popov. Olga Popova has been a partner of the gallery since 2011. The gallery presents Russian and European artists. It takes part in the largest contemporary art fairs in Russia and Europe. The gallery has organized several dozen museum projects in Russia. In 2012-2014, there was a branch in Berlin. It is located at the Winzavod Contemporary Art Center in Moscow. Since 2023, the gallery’s second branch, pop/off/art 2.0, has opened its doors at 9, Bolshoy Palashevsky Lane.
